Freestyle Libre 1

Additionally it is possible to use a specific watch, the Sony Smartwatch 3 which has an NFC chip which can be enabled and can be used as a NFC collector. As it currently stands, if using Libre 1 as BG source you cannot activate ‘Enable SMB always’ and ‘Enable SMB after carbs’ within the SMB algorithm. The BG values of Libre 1 are not smooth enough to use it safely. See Smoothing blood glucose data for more details.

If using Glimp == == == == == == == == == == == == == == == == == == == == == == == == == == == == == == == == == == == == == == == * You will need Glimp version 4.15.57 or newer. Older versions are not supported. * If not already set up then download Glimp and follow instructions on Nightscout. * Select Glimp in ConfigBuilder (setting in AndroidAPS).
